    I havent really considered making more of them, although I have plenty of spare material left... The problem is, my brother did the welding, and Id have to bug him to do it for me again :P

    The basket actually presses into the handle, so theres no way itll come out with a hit onto a knock box. Ill make a video today if I have time. The last picture I posted was of the second shot I pulled, and after a solid knock or two into the knock box, one solid puck came out
